END GAME? – AT 7:02 P.M. ET:  Virginia, under its aggressive conservative government, is moving to get a final judicial verdict on the constitutionality of Obamacare:

RICHMOND - Virginia will ask that the U.S. Supreme Court immediately review the state's constitutional challenge to the federal health-care overhaul, a rare legal request to bypass appeals and ask for early intervention from the nation's highest court, Attorney General Ken T. Cuccinelli II said Thursday.

Cuccinelli (R) said that conflicting court decisions about the law's constitutionality have created sufficient uncertainty about implementation of the sweeping law to justify speeding Supreme Court review.

The Justice Department will oppose the motion, saying that the case should be fully heard by lower courts before the Supreme Court takes action.

The high court has granted such requests infrequently, and many experts said they think Cuccinelli's filing is a longshot. Supporters of the law said that the provision at the heart of the legal dispute - a requirement that individuals buy health insurance - will not go into effect until 2014.

COMMENT:  Eventually, this will go to the high court.   My own view, as a citizen, is that the court should grant Cuccinelli's motion because health care is so central to American life and the American economy.  Although the individual mandate, requiring that individuals buy health insurance, doesn't formally go into effect until 2014, it is at the heart of the law, and the heart of the uncertainty.
